The Charlotte County Sheriff’s Office has the radar guns working in two places next week.

Starting Monday, deputies look for speeders intently on Highway 41 in Punta Gorda between Jones Loop and Oil Well roads. They also do the same on Cornelius Boulevard in Port Charlotte between Highway 41 and State Road 776.

The office also enforces traffic lights and stop signs more greatly in Port Charlotte at two intersections with Highway 41: Midway Boulevard and Cochran Boulevard.
